How do semi trucks reduce drag?

FAIRINGS AND SIDE SKIRTS Fairing panels are also known as “rear tails” or “trailer tails.” Place these devices at the back end of your semi-truck to limit the pressure vacuum causing unwanted drag. Simply remove the technology from the cargo area when you’re ready to open doors for deliveries.

What is the average miles per gallon for a semi truck?

In 1973, federal agencies estimated that semi trucks got 5.6 miles per gallon on average. Today, that number is around 6.5 miles per gallon on average. But remember, that’s on average. It’s been reported that some diesel semi trucks achieve 8 mpg or more.

What gas mileage do 18 wheelers get?

Since semi-trucks are so heavy, they aren’t the most fuel-efficient vehicles on the market. On average, semi-trucks get only 6.5 miles per gallon. Their efficiency ranges wildly between 3 mpg going up hills to more than 23 mpg going downhill.
